当前位置: 首页 > news >正文

百度给做网站收费多少/今日新闻国际最新消息

百度给做网站收费多少,今日新闻国际最新消息,帝国网站地图模板,做私人彩票网站PostgreSQL中支持多种类型的数据类型,其中数组类型在pg中也是被频繁使用的一种,我们可以定义某列为变长多维数组。 那么对于不同数组我们怎么获取数组的交集,进行去除交集等操作呢? 对于字符串,我们可以使用except来直…

PostgreSQL中支持多种类型的数据类型,其中数组类型在pg中也是被频繁使用的一种,我们可以定义某列为变长多维数组。
那么对于不同数组我们怎么获取数组的交集,进行去除交集等操作呢?
对于字符串,我们可以使用except来直接进行去除交集,那么数组该怎么办呢?

对于数组的去除交集我们的思路大致为:
1、先把数组转换成字符串;
2、将字符串的元素拆分然后进行去除交集;
3、将获得的字符串转换成数组。

例子:
我们使用上述的思路来将[1,2,3,4,5]和[2,3]这两个数组进行去除交集。

1、数组转换字符串

bill=# select array_to_string(array[1,2,3,4,5],',');array_to_string 
-----------------1,2,3,4,5
(1 row)

2、拆分字符串

bill=# select regexp_split_to_table(array_to_string(array[1,2,3,4,5],',') ,',');regexp_split_to_table 
-----------------------12345
(5 rows)

3、对拆分的元素进行去除交集

bill=# select regexp_split_to_table(array_to_string(array[1,2,3,4,5],',') ,',') except select regexp_split_to_table(array_to_string(array[2,3],','),',');regexp_split_to_table 
-----------------------451
(3 rows)

4、将去除交集后的字符串转换成数组

bill=# select array(select regexp_split_to_table(array_to_string(array[1,2,3,4,5],',') ,',') except select regexp_split_to_table(array_to_string(array[2,3],','),','));array  
---------{4,5,1}
(1 row)

参考链接:
https://www.postgresql.org/docs/12/arrays.html
https://www.postgresql.org/docs/12/functions-array.html

http://www.lbrq.cn/news/931987.html

相关文章:

  • 上海网站建设微信开发/重庆seo招聘
  • 做网站交易平台挣钱吗/东莞seo托管
  • 阿里云建设网站好不好/软文是什么意思通俗点
  • 管理网站建设/培训机构招生7个方法
  • 安装wordpress没有选择语言/seo推广优化培训
  • html个人网站设计模板/茂名百度seo公司
  • 凡客建站网/免费网站推广网站破解版
  • 代做一个网站多少钱/网络营销专业技能
  • 做网站需要哪些东西/产品推广活动策划方案
  • 国内网站有哪些/seo推广专员
  • 网站动画用什么程序做/舆情监测软件
  • 网站开发概要设计/深圳营销推广公司
  • pc网站怎么做自适应/广东seo推广
  • mooc 网站建设情况/seo是什么姓
  • ps做网站效果图都是按几倍做/个人建网站步骤
  • 网站建设需要什么软件/seo搜索引擎优化课程总结
  • 赣州网站制作找哪家好/网络服务提供者不是网络运营者
  • 有域名了怎么做网站/企业软文范例
  • 怎么做网站详情页/宁波seo在线优化哪家好
  • 宁波网站建设制作订做/常州网站建设
  • 个人怎么做网站页面/seo单页快速排名
  • 网站设计师要求/武汉seo哪家好
  • 济南网站制作费用/亚马逊开店流程及费用
  • wap网站开发价格/软件推广
  • 深圳商城网站制作公司/seo百度推广
  • 兰州网站运营/工具
  • 县城购物网站/搜图片百度识图
  • 网站设计需求表/昆明百度推广优化
  • 手机在线做ppt模板下载网站有哪些/最近一周新闻大事摘抄
  • 国内wordpress有名的网站/百度搜索网站
  • Rust在CentOS 6上的移植
  • 吃透 B + 树:MySQL 索引的底层逻辑与避坑指南
  • Redis深度剖析:从基础到实战(上)
  • 【worklist】worklist的hl7、dicom是什么关系
  • 【LeetCode】链表反转实现与测试
  • LLM 模型部署难题的技术突破:从轻量化到分布式推理的全栈解决方案